TURN-208: Gatevale turnstile counters at the Merrow Field pilot double-count when a rotation reverses mid-cycle. Attendance totals drift roughly 2% high per event. The debounce window fix is implemented, reviewed by Ilsa, and soak-tested across two simulated match days without drift. Ready for your cut; the candidate build is identified below.

trace token, tagag-tafog: htk6_5ed18c

Ticket: Reception desk relocation, Dunmore Point. The main reception desk moves from level 1 to the ground floor this Friday. Night shift: from 22:00 Thursday the level 1 desk will be unstaffed and the phone diverted. Direct all couriers and visitors to the new ground-floor desk by the east entrance. The east entrance door remains locked overnight; staff should enter using the pass code below.

door code, kawip-bagap: bdg-HQEWH-4

### Archiving cold buckets

When a Frostbin bucket hits 18 months without a read, it's fair game for archival. Run the sweep script from the ops jumpbox, not your laptop — the Glacierhouse endpoint only accepts traffic from inside the Tarnfield VPC. The script tags, snapshots, then seals each bucket. It authenticates to the internal Glacierhouse API using the key below.

service key, fawip-bajef: kto11_Qt5wZK9vdNC

Subject: Cut-over complete — build agent clock skew resolved

Team,

The cut-over to the new Quillhaven time-sync service finished last night. As you know, several Brindlework build agents had drifted by up to 40 seconds, which caused artifact timestamps to land out of order and broke cache validation for three pipelines. All agents now sync against the internal stratum pool, and we verified skew is under 50 milliseconds across the fleet. If a customer reports stale build artifacts, check skew first. The new agent configuration is below.

service settings:
novath:
  pin: 1396
  tenant: pelys
  seal: seal_ccc035e1
  metrics_host: metrics.novath.qorvelworks.test
  standby_team: fraeth
  escalation: drueth-zorok
  nonce: 61d508

## Service Accounts — StormFan Alert Fan-Out

The fan-out worker authenticates to the internal dispatch tier using the svc-stormfan account. Rotate quarterly; scopes are limited to publish-only on alert topics. If deliveries stall during your shift, verify the worker is using the current credential, reproduced below for reference.

API key for kaweg-hahif: kto4_rAjZ